It's that time of the year again, when we celebrate a free Kenya and its amazing people. I bet you think there isn't much to do on Jamhuri Day, huh?
Surprise, surprise, the day is not only about  presidential-led ceremonies with speeches capable of boring you stiff. There are lots of fun things to get yourself stuck into. You deserve to take this opportunity to explore Nairobi and all of its unique, trendy spots. Get on the bandwagon and make your day off count.
1. Movie mania
If you've been craving the big screen, this is your chance. Drive or take an Uber to the nearest cinema spot and enjoy some popcorn and a film. This can be that one moment you have to take your crush on a date. There's no better time to catch the all new blockbuster Aquaman. Be sure to beat the hassle by booking your advance tickets here.
2. Ice skating at the Panari Hotel
Didn't know there was an ice rink in Nairobi? Well, you're welcome.
3. Bowling bigger than LeBron
Be competitive and invite some friends to a game or two at the newly refurbished bowling alley at Village Market. Challenge yourself and show your friends what you've got.
4. Breakfast for dinner?
Because why not? Break the norm. Be a rebel.
5. Thrift it up
Take an adventure to Gikomba and cop yourself a pair of those cute converses. Mix up your style and find out all the unique items you can get at the mitumba stores.
